PRODUCED BY BILL STEVENSON AND JASON LIVERMORE for the Blasting Room ENGINEERED BY JASON LIVERMORE, BILL STEVENSON, ANDREW BERLIN RECORDED AT THE BLASTING ROOM, FORT COLLINS, COLORADO ADDITIONAL PRODUCTION BYANDREW BERLIN MIXED BY CHRIS LORD-ALGE AT MIX LA, TARZANA, CA ASSISTED BY NIK KARPEN & KEITH ARMSTRONG ADDITIONAL ENGINEERING BY BRAD TOWNSEND AND ANDREW SHUBERT MASTERED BY TED JENSEN AT STERLING SOUND NY, NY BACKING VOCALS CHAD PRICE BACKING VOCALS ON Make It Stop (September's Children) MILES STEVENSON, MADDIE STEVENSON, STACIE STEVENSON & TESS YOUNG BACKING VOCALs ON MIdNIGHT HANDS MATT SKIBA CATCH-22 CLIP on Survivor Guilt PERFORMED BY ART GARFUNKEL AND MARCEL DALIO LICENSED THROUGH PARAMOUNT PICTURES. ALL SONGS WRITTEN AND PERFORMED BY RISE AGAINST ALL LYRICS BY TIM MCILRATH DO IT TO WIN MUSIC/SONY ATV/ASCAP RISE AGAINST IS TIM MCILRATH vocals/guitar JOE PRINCIPE bass/backing vocals BRANDON BARNES drums/backing vocals ZACH BLAIR guitar/backing vocals A&R THOM PANUNZIO A&R COORDINATOR EVAN PETERS MANAGeMENT MISSY WORTH FOR ARTISTIC LICENSE BOOKING CORRIE CHRISTOPHER INTERNATIONAL BOOKING AGENT MARLENE TSUCHII LEGAL STACY FASS MARKETING BRIAN FRANK MARKETING COORDINATOR KAVI HALEMANE CREATIVE IANTHE ZEVOS PHOTOgraphy EVAN HUNT ALBUM ARTWORK DINA HOVSEPIAN RISE AGAINST WOULD LIKE TO THANK ALL OUR FRIENDS, FAMILY AND ALL THE BANDS THAT WE HAVE PLAYED WITH.
